2️⃣ Strategy Wednesday — July Focus

From the Opening to the Endgame: Typical Endgames in the French Defense

👤 Coach: GM Ioannis Papaioannou 📅 Dates: 22.07.2026 & 29.07.2026 🔗 Event page: https://www.modern-chess.com/event/from-the-opening-to-the-endgame-typical-endgames-in-the-french-defense/82385/

The French Defense is defined by its endgames: the middlegame battles flow, again and again, into the same recurring family of endings. The backward d-pawn, the "bad" light-squared bishop, the queenside pawn majority, and the locked structures that suddenly open are not accidents of a particular game — they define whole classes of French endgames, for both colours.

This camp covers those recurring endgame structures across the French. You will learn how strong players steer the middlegame toward favorable endgames, evaluate the typical French structures and minor-piece imbalances, and convert small but durable structural advantages into full points. The focus is on the phase where French games are actually won and lost.

3️⃣ Tactical Thursday — July Focus

Strategic Calculation and Calculating Long Variations

👤 Coach: GM Swapnil Dhopade 📅 Dates: 16.07.2026 & 23.07.2026 🔗 Event page: https://www.modern-chess.com/event/tactical-thursday-july-2026-strategic-calculation-and-calculating-long-variations/32418/

Not all calculation is tactical. When there is a combination on the board, the moves announce themselves; the far greater challenge is calculation in quiet, strategic positions, where the candidate moves are not forcing and the evaluation at the end of a long line is a matter of judgment.

This camp trains exactly that — how to calculate accurately in strategic positions, and how to calculate long, branching variations without losing the thread. You will learn how strong players choose candidate moves when nothing is forced, calculate long lines to the point where a position can be judged, and combine calculation with positional judgment to evaluate what they find.
